Ingredients
- 1/4 c. Panko breadcrumbs
- 1/2 T. paprika
- 1/4 t. onion powder
- 1/4 t. garlic powder
- 1/4 t. salt
- 1/8 t. black pepper
- 2 pork chops, trimmed of fat
- 1/4 c. low fat buttermilk
Details
Servings 2
Cooking time 30mins
Preparation
Step 1
Preheat the oven to 500 degrees. Line a baking sheet with nonstick foil. Spray foil with olive oil cooking spray.
Combine breadcrumbs and all the seasonings in a dredging container; set aside. Place the buttermilk in another shallow dredging container; set aside.
Place the pork chops between sheets of wax paper. Pound them to 1/4" thickness using the smooth side of a meat mallet.
Dip the both sides of the chops in the buttermilk, then coat both sides with the bread crumb mixture. Place the chops on the prepared baking sheet and bake until browned, about 12 minutes.
